ART STUDIO TOUR

Sept. 19 & 20, 2009

Ever wanted to see the inside of an artist’s studio?

From 10 a.m. to 6 p.m. on Sept. 19 and 20 the public is invited to visit seven unique art studios featuring eight artists from the greater Estes Valley in the fourth annual open studio tour slated in and around Estes Park, Colorado.

The annual Estes Park Art Studio Tour is an opportunity for the public to watch artists as they work, ask questions, and to experience the art process in each artist's habitat. The event is sponsored by the Cultural Arts Council of Estes Park, and it is free and open to the public.

A variety of art techniques and styles will be featured on the tour including painting, ceramics, woodworking, drawing and mixed media/collage.  Studios feature both two and three-dimensional art forms. Subject matter includes landscape, portraiture, abstract and contemporary designs in functional and decorative styles.  Artwork will be available for purchase from the artists all weekend long.

The 2009 tour features:
Leah Simmons DeCapio Studio, Pottery
Karen Dick Studio, Ceramics
Deedee Hampton Studio, Oil and Mixed Media Collage
Patricia Henriksen Greenberg Studio, Pencil
John Lynch Woodworking Studio, Woodworking
Cecy Turner Studio, Oil
Cydney Springer , Oil
Greig Steiner , Oil and Mixed Media

Maps are available at the CAC Fine Art Gallery located at 423 W. Elkhorn Ave., the Estes Park Convention and Visitor’s Bureau, 500 Big Thompson Ave., or at participating studios.
